Mexican Bean Chilli

with Cheesy Sweet Potato & Smokey Corn Cobs

We've packed this bake with classic Mexican flavours, plus a spicy kick for those who want it! The rich red kidney bean chilli is topped with tender cubes of sweet potato and a scattering of cheese. Plus, try our technique for smokey, Mexican-style corn on the cob – one bite and you'll be hooked!

Cooking Steps

roast the sweet potato
1

Preheat the oven 240°C/220°C fan-forced. Cut the sweet potato (unpeeled) into 1cm cubes. Place the sweet potato on the oven tray lined with baking paper, drizzle with olive oil and season with a pinch of salt and pepper. Toss to coat, then roast until just tender, 20 minutes. TIP: Cut the sweet potato to the correct size so it cooks in the allocated time.

prep
2

While the sweet potato is roasting, cut the red capsicum into 1cm chunks. Slice the corn cob in half. Roughly chop the coriander. Grate the carrot (unpeeled). Drain and rinse the red kidney beans. Bring a medium saucepan of salted water to the boil.

start the chilli
3

SPICY! Use less of the spice blend if you're sensitive to heat. In a large frying pan, heat a drizzle of olive oil over a high heat. When the oil is hot, add the capsicum and cook, stirring occasionally, until softened and charred, 4-5 minutes. Reduce the heat to medium-high. Add the red kidney beans and grated carrot and cook until softened, 2 minutes. Add the Mexican Fiesta spice blend and stir until fragrant, 1 minute.

bake
4

Add the diced tomatoes, brown sugar, crumbled vegetable stock (1 cube for 2 people / 2 cubes for 4 people) and stir through the butter. Season to taste with salt and pepper, then transfer to a medium baking dish. Top the bean mixture with the roasted sweet potato, then sprinkle with the shredded Cheddar cheese. Bake until the cheese has melted and the bean mixture is bubbling, 10 minutes.

cook corn
5

While the chilli is baking, add the corn to the saucepan of boiling water and cook until the kernels are bright yellow, 3-4 minutes. Drain. Wipe out the large frying pan and return to a high heat. Add the corn and cook, turning occasionally, until lightly charred all over, 5 minutes. Spread some smokey aioli (see ingredients list) over a plate and roll the corn in the aioli to coat.

serve
6

Divide the spiced veggie chilli and smokey corn cobs between plates. Top with the Greek yoghurt and sprinkle with coriander.
